25 Final Year Project Ideas for ECE Students
IoT-Based Smart Agriculture System
Develop an agriculture monitoring system using ESP32 or Arduino to measure soil moisture, temperature, humidity, and other environmental parameters.
Smart Home Automation Using IoT
Build a system for controlling lights, fans, and electrical appliances using IoT and mobile or web-based control.
Raspberry Pi-Based Object Detection
Develop a real-time object detection system using Raspberry Pi, camera modules, Python, and OpenCV.
AI-Based Face Recognition Door Lock
Create an intelligent access-control system using a camera, face recognition, microcontroller, and electronic locking mechanism.
IoT-Based Air Quality Monitoring
Monitor temperature, humidity, gas concentration, and air-quality parameters using sensors and an IoT dashboard.
Smart Energy Monitoring System
Measure voltage, current, power consumption, and electrical parameters using sensors and an IoT-based monitoring platform.
IoT-Based Water Quality Monitoring
Monitor pH, turbidity, TDS, temperature, and other water-quality parameters using connected sensors.
Smart Irrigation System
Develop an automatic irrigation system that uses soil moisture sensors to control water supply to crops.
IoT-Based Fire Detection System
Build a system that detects fire and abnormal temperature conditions and provides real-time alerts.
ESP32-Based Health Monitoring System
Develop a prototype for monitoring parameters such as heart rate, SpO2, and temperature using suitable sensors.
Vehicle Accident Detection System
Use sensors, GPS, and communication modules to detect possible vehicle accidents and transmit location information.
Smart Parking System Using IoT
Develop a parking system that detects available spaces using sensors and displays real-time parking information.
RFID-Based Attendance System
Create an automated attendance system using RFID cards, a microcontroller, database integration, and a web dashboard.
GPS-Based Vehicle Tracking System
Develop a real-time vehicle tracking prototype using GPS, communication modules, and an online monitoring dashboard.
IoT-Based Weather Monitoring System
Measure temperature, humidity, atmospheric pressure, and other environmental parameters using sensors and IoT connectivity.
Robotics-Based Obstacle Avoidance System
Build an autonomous robot that detects obstacles using ultrasonic or other sensors and changes its movement accordingly.
Line Following Robot
Develop a robot that automatically follows a predefined path using IR sensors and a microcontroller.
AI-Based Drone Detection System
Develop an experimental system for detecting drones using computer vision or audio-based Artificial Intelligence techniques.
Smart Cooking Monitoring System
Monitor cooking temperature, voltage, current, fire conditions, and cooling status using sensors and an IoT dashboard.
IoT-Based Industrial Equipment Monitoring
Develop a monitoring system that collects machine parameters such as temperature, vibration, voltage, and current.
Voice-Controlled Home Automation
Create a voice-controlled automation prototype for operating household appliances using embedded and IoT technologies.
GSM-Based Security Alert System
Develop a security system that detects unauthorized activity and sends alerts using GSM communication.
IoT-Based Pollution Monitoring System
Monitor environmental pollution parameters and display collected data through a web or cloud-based dashboard.
Smart Waste Management System
Develop an IoT-based system that monitors waste-bin levels and provides information for efficient waste collection.
Embedded AI-Based Object Classification
Build an embedded computer vision prototype that identifies predefined objects using a camera and an AI model.
These ECE project ideas can be customized based on the student's academic requirements, available components, project complexity, budget, and preferred technology.
